Implementation Process for the Massachusetts Grant Program

The state of Massachusetts offers grants to support artists facing unexpected medical, dental, and mental health emergencies. This program provides crucial financial assistance to individual artists engaged in various forms of visual arts, film, video, electronic, digital arts, and choreography. Understanding the implementation process is key for eligible applicants seeking to access these grants effectively.

Application Workflow

To leverage this grant opportunity, artists in Massachusetts should follow a structured application process designed to facilitate quick approvals. The workflow is straightforward, ensuring that eligible candidates can apply without unnecessary complications.

  1. Eligibility Check: Before starting the application, ensure you meet the eligibility requirements. The most important criterion is being an individual artist who is in financial need due to unforeseen health emergencies. It’s also essential to be actively engaged in a qualifying art form.

  2. Gather Documentation: Collect all necessary documentation that evidences your financial need. This may include medical bills, emergency statements, and proof of income. Documentation should clearly demonstrate the impact of the emergency on your financial situation.

  3. Complete the Online Application: The application is primarily submitted online through the Massachusetts Arts Council's website. Carefully fill out all required fields, ensuring accuracy. Pay particular attention to the sections that ask for details about your artistic work and the financial emergency you are facing.

  4. Submission Deadline: Be mindful of submission deadlines. Applications will generally be accepted on a rolling basis, but it’s crucial to apply as soon as you are ready. Processing times may vary, so earlier submission could expedite fund availability.

  5. Review Process: Once submitted, your application will undergo a review process by designated state officials. They will assess the completeness and accuracy of your application and the legitimacy of your financial need.

  6. Grant Award Notification: If approved, you will receive a notification of your grant award via email. This communication will include instructions on how to receive your funds. Expect to receive the grant amount (up to $5,000) directly deposited into your specified bank account.

Timeline for Application

The timeline for applying and receiving funds can significantly affect your ability to manage health emergencies. Below is a general overview of what to expect during the application process in Massachusetts:

  • Application Completion: Ideally, applicants should allow at least one week to gather documentation and finalize the online application.
  • Processing Time: Once submitted, the reviewing process can take anywhere from two to four weeks, depending on the volume of applications being processed. It’s advisable to check in with the Massachusetts Arts Council if you haven't received feedback within this timeframe.
  • Funding Release: For successful applications, funds are typically disbursed within a week of approval notifications.

FAQs for Massachusetts Grant Applicants

Q: What types of emergencies are covered by the grant? A: The grant covers recent unexpected medical, dental, and mental health emergencies that impact individual artists financially.

Q: Can I apply if I have already received funds from another grant? A: Yes, you can apply for this grant even if you have received funding from other sources, provided your current need is due to a distinct emergency.

Q: Is there a cap on the number of applications I can submit? A: Generally, applicants are encouraged to submit one application per emergency situation, as funds are limited and funds are intended to address specific needs rather than multiple circumstances.
